The state of surface site of catalyst for CO hydrogenation was studied with TPSR, TPR and TR. Results show that there are two kinds of active sites on the surface of Ni/Al_2O_3 catalysts. The site A comes from crystallite of Ni exposed on the surface, while the site B comes from Ni-Al intermediate which formed by the strong interaction of Ni with the support Al_2O_3. Results also show that the CO can be adsorbed on both sites, if active hydrogen is adsorbed on the surface, the ratio of adsorbed CO on both sites will be changed.
